Output 24f640862618b79fd093c938526f83f46c0cb3f5295f3ba189e2a71e9fb3d45f:1

value
139982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 604eb5ae8c4aa4b14727f1bc59f6a3124e8ba541 OP_EQUAL
address
3AUF5oe3m1xDgzLPRnzmRnDULGqqpFwCQC
transaction
24f640862618b79fd093c938526f83f46c0cb3f5295f3ba189e2a71e9fb3d45f
spent
true